Scientific Notation

Consists of two parts

1. mantissa

The full size number that comes before x 102. characteristicThe exponent that comes after x 10 and is superscriptSlide5

Scientific Notation

Example:

3.00

x 10

15

Mantissa

CharacteristicSlide6

Scientific Notation

To convert a normal number to scientific notation, move the decimal either to the left or right until you have a mantissa which is greater than -10 or less than +10Slide7

Scientific Notation

If the absolute value of the number is smaller than 1, the characteristic will be negative

If the absolute value of the number is larger than 1, the characteristic will be positiveSlide8

Scientific Notation

Example:

542

The absolute value of the number is greater than one so the characteristic is positive

542

Moved to the left two spaces

5.42 x 10

2Slide9

Scientific Notation

Example:

-45000000

The absolute value of the number is greater than one so the characteristic is positive

-45000000

Moved to the left seven spaces

-4.5 x 10

7Slide10

Example:

0.0040

The absolute value of the number is less than one so the characteristic is negative

0.0040

Moved to the right three spaces

4.0 x 10

-3Slide11

Example:

-0.209

The absolute value of the number is less than one so the characteristic is negative

-0.209

Moved to the right one space

-2.09 x 10

-1Slide12

Example

:

9.245

The absolute value of the number is between -10 and +10.

9.245

The decimal is not moved. In this case, the characteristic is zero.

9.245 x10

0Slide13

Expanding Scientific Notation to Regular notation

If the characteristic is positive, move the decimal to the right.

If the characteristic is negative, move the decimal to the left.Slide19

Expanding Scientific Notation to Regular notation

Example

6.50 x 10

2

The characteristic tells us to move two places to the right.

650.Slide20

Expanding Scientific Notation to Regular notation

Example

6.50 x 10

-2

The characteristic tells us to move two places to the left.

0.0650Slide21

Fixing Incorrect Scientific Notation

Fix the mantissa by moving the decimal

Add the “fixed” characteristic to the original characteristicSlide26

Example

20.4 x 10

6

(incorrect)

Moved over one space to the left (+) to correct the mantissa

2.04 x 10

(6+1)

2.04 x 10

7

(correct)Slide27

Example

200.4 x 10

-6

(incorrect)

Moved over two spaces to the left (+) to correct the mantissa

2.004 x 10

(-6+2)

2.004 x 10

-4

(correct)Slide28

Example

0.00340 x 10

8

(incorrect)

Moved over three spaces to the right (-) to correct the mantissa

3.40 x 10

(8 + -3)

3.40 x 10

5

(correct)Slide29

Example

0.00340 x 10

-8

(incorrect)

Moved over three spaces to the right (-) to correct the mantissa

3.40 x 10

(-8 + -3)

3.40 x 10

-11

(correct)Slide30

Adding and Subtracting Scientific Notation

The mantissa MUST have the same characteristic.

Then add or subtract the mantissa.

Finally correct the scientific notation if neededSlide35

Multiplying Numbers in Scientific Notation

Multiply the mantissas

ADD the characteristics together

Correct the number if the mantissas are +10 or greater/-10 or less.Slide36

Dividing Numbers in Scientific Notation

Divide the mantissas

Subtract the characteristic of the denominator from the characteristic of the numerator

Correct the number if the mantissas are +10 or greater/-10 or less.
